Causes behind the Jet lag

You might have recently returned after spending Christmas with your family and facing a Jet Lag. Primarily, the time zone is one of the biggest issues in your opinion but wait. Here are more causes of jet lag-

  • Your circadian rhythms are changed due to flying in between different zones. You are present in a new location and your body lacks the knowledge about time and fails to function like previously.
  • Changing sunsets makes Melatonin production in one's body. Melatonin helps your cells work together and attain a balance; thus, your body lacks sunlight and cannot regulate itself.
  • You lacked proper hydration while traveling. Additionally, you might develop jet lag successively due to humidity levels being low in planes.

How can you prevent insomnia during Jet Lags?

Inclusion of some basic steps in your daily routine will help in treating jet lags successively-

  • Always try to arrive early before your meeting has been scheduled. This would help your body to adjust itself to shifting time zones.
  • Try to remain hydrated while traveling. Moreover, try to get an ample amount of rest before you have your trips planned.
  • Make adjustments in your schedule before you are planning to leave your location. If you are thinking of moving towards the east then try to sleep earlier than habituated. Moving towards the west will require you to shift your sleep one hour later.
  • Making light exposure would help you in treating with Strong sleeping pills UK for Jet lag. If you have traveled towards the west, try going out for evening walks, and while shifting towards the east, accustom yourself to morning lights.
